Data centres gain their own insurance bracket as business risk increases

Insurance coverage firm Willis has launched an eight-point digital infrastructure framework that classifies knowledge centres as a standalone systemic insurance coverage class. The agency says the change displays a change within the danger profile of knowledge centres. It’s been influenced by the function DC property now play in cloud and AI workloads.

Asserting the framework on 28 January, Willis states conventional approaches based mostly on single-line property placements don’t mirror the operational nor monetary actuality of huge knowledge centre portfolios. In its view, trendy services work as related infrastructure with dependencies that embrace energy, networks, and provide chains, and surmount geopolitics. Losses are typically correlated in a single coverage or a single line-of-business.

Willis stated it has secured in extra of $3 billion of insurance coverage capability for hyperscale developments, anticipating the information centre phase to generate round $10 billion of premium in 2026, figures that present how the market has expanded, and a reassessment of how capital will get allotted to the sector.

George Haitsch, North America know-how, media and telecoms business chief at Willis, stated knowledge centres now resemble vital provide chain parts. Exposures are broader and extra complicated than these assumed in earlier underwriting fashions. He stated insurance coverage must be structured as a framework that comes with danger mitigation early in design and building.

The agency describes its coverage as stopping the therapy of knowledge centres as high-limit property accounts and managing them as cross-class infrastructure portfolios. Underneath this view, property injury, building danger, cybersecurity occasions, political affect, and operational interruption may every be contingent on different elements, and must be assessed as an entire. Willis stated its framework is designed to handle danger throughout a facility’s full lifecycle, with explicit give attention to stability sheet safety for DC homeowners and operators.

Power safety sits on the centre of such considerations. AI-driven campuses’ elevated energy consumption means the elevated chance of enterprise interruption losses being linked to grid failures. Such occasions can have an effect on a number of websites concurrently, notably the place services depend on the identical infrastructure.

FM has stated it insures round 1,100 knowledge centres with a mixed insurable worth of roughly $250 billion, a determine that displays the price of the buildings and tools and is indicative of the potential losses from enterprise interruption and firms reneging on any service stage agreements.

The market in knowledge centre enterprise interruption cowl has expanded lately. A current market evaluation estimated world premiums for devoted knowledge centre enterprise interruption insurance coverage at about $3.9 billion in 2024, and there are projections that this would possibly double by 2033. The upper financial dependence on steady availability of DCs goes some strategy to explaining the expansion on this phase.

The Willis framework exhibits how giant brokers and insurers are repositioning knowledge centres of their portfolios. As an alternative of DCs being a specialised nook of economic property, services are more and more thought of as core digital infrastructure. In AI-focused economies, such a reclassification has implications for underwriting and danger accumulation that proceed to evolve.
